Conversion decays of light vector mesons and QED process e+e-→e+e-γγ at 2E∼1 GeV

Description
Conversion decays of light vector mesons ρ, ω, φ→π0e+e-, π0μ+μ-, ηe+e-, ημ+μ- and QED process e+e-→e+e-γγ are considered. Comparison of available experimental data and theoretical predictions is given. Prospects of further examination of these processes in VEPP-2000 e+e- collider energy region 2E≤2 GeV are discussed
